PowerBI-日期和时间函数-UTCTODAY\UTCNOW

UTCTODAY

释义:返回以协调世界时(UTC)表示的日期时间格式所显示的当前日期

语法:UTCTODAY()

备注:

  • 仅当刷新公式时,UTCNOW 函数的结果才会更改。 它不会连续更新

示例:返回UTC当前日期

UTCTODAY()

UTCNOW

释义:返回以协调世界时(UTC)表示的日期时间格式所显示的当前日期和时间

语法:UTCNOW()

备注:

  • UTCTODAY为所有日期返回时间值 12:00:00 PM
  • UTCNOW函数与之类似,但会返回准确的时间和日期

示例:返回UTC当前日期和时间

UTCNOW()
在 Flask-SQLAlchemy 中处理日期时间数据主要依赖于 Python 的 `datetime` 模块。SQLAlchemy ORM 本身支持与 `datetime` 对象交互,你可以在定义数据库模型时使用这些对象来处理日期时间字段。下面是如何在 Flask-SQLAlchemy 中定义和使用日期时间字段的一个简单示例: 1. 首先,确保你已经导入了 SQLAlchemy 和 datetime 模块。 ```python from flask_sqlalchemy import SQLAlchemy from datetime import datetime ``` 2. 接下来,在你的 Flask 应用中初始化 SQLAlchemy。 ```python app = Flask(__name__) db = SQLAlchemy(app) ``` 3. 定义一个模型,并在其中添加日期时间字段。你可以使用 `db.Column` 来定义字段,并指定数据类型为 `db.DateTime`。 ```python class Event(db.Model): id = db.Column(db.Integer, primary_key=True) date_created = db.Column(db.DateTime, default=datetime.utcnow) date_modified = db.Column(db.DateTime, default=datetime.utcnow, onupdate=datetime.utcnow) ``` 在这个例子中,`date_created` 和 `date_modified` 字段分别被创建来存储创建和修改事件的时间戳。`default=datetime.utcnow` 表示字段的默认值是当前的 UTC 时间。`onupdate=datetime.utcnow` 表示每次更新记录时,字段都会自动设置为当前的 UTC 时间。 4. 在你的应用中,你可以使用这些字段来插入、查询或更新日期时间数据。 例如,创建一个新的 Event 记录: ```python new_event = Event() db.session.add(new_event) db.session.commit() ``` 查询所有事件,并按创建时间排序: ```python events = Event.query.order_by(Event.date_created).all() ``` 更新特定事件的修改时间: ```python event_to_update = Event.query.get(1) event_to_update.date_modified = datetime.utcnow() db.session.commit() ```
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值